The yeast Saccharomyces cerevisiae is a common model organism for biological discovery. It has become popularized primarily because it is biochemically and genetically amenable for many fundamental studies on eukaryotic cells. The utility of single molecule fluorescence (SMF) for understanding biological reactions has been amply demonstrated by a diverse series of studies over the last decade.
